Description

A rich small specimen featuring white artsmithite associated with crude crystals of calomel, rich yellow eglestonite, and minor native mercury.  There are a few pale green crystals that may be terlinguaite.   Artsmithite is a rare one locality species, the first mercury bearing phosphate.
